J454 GHD is a 1991 Mercedes Motorhome in White with a 3,972c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 1991 Mercedes Motorhome models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.2% with a typical mileage of 145,615 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mercedes Motorhome f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 249 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J454 GHD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es Motorhome typically stays on UK roads for around 45 years. At 35 years old, this Mercedes Motorhome is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
